Responsibilities
- Assist licensed electricians in installing, maintaining, and repairing electrical systems on construction sites.
- Read and interpret electrical schematics, blueprints, and technical drawings to support project execution.
- Use hand tools, power tools, and testing equipment such as ohmmeters to perform wiring tasks safely and accurately.
- Follow strict electrical safety procedures, including NFPA 70 (National Fire Protection Association code) compliance and high-voltage safety protocols.
- Support the installation of low voltage systems and ensure proper wiring according to NEC (National Electrical Code) standards.
- Maintain a clean and organized work environment while adhering to construction site safety standards.
- Collaborate with team members to complete projects efficiently while ensuring quality workmanship.
